Mandeep Kaur visits Udhampur; inspects sewerage plant, sites for housing colonies
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

UDHAMPUR, JANUARY 22: Commissioner Secretary, Housing & Urban Development Department, Mandeep Kaur, today conducted an extensive tour of Udhampur district today.

During the visit, Commissioner Secretary inspected work on Devika Rejuvenation Project, Sewerage Treatment Plant 1 and 3 (STP-1 and 3) and Devika Ghat.

During her visit, she stressed on maintaining cleanliness at the Ghat besides ensuring connection of all houses with the treatment plant. She directed the Chief Executive Officer, Municipal Council Udhampur, to ensure door to door collection of garbage besides ensuring proper disposal of the same.

Accompanied by Deputy Commissioner, Saloni Rai, Chief Engineer, UEED, Naseer Ahmed Kakroo, Additional District Development Commissioner, Ghan Sham Singh, Director ULB, Jammu, Puneet Sharma, MD Housing Jammu, Shabir Hussain Keen, Additional Deputy Commissioner, Joginder Singh Jasrotia, Assistant Commissioner Revenue, Rafiq Ahmed Jaral and other officers, the Commissioner Secretary also visited the sites identified by the district administration for development of two housing colonies.

Mandeep Kaur directed the officers to ensure cleanliness and beautification of the urban areas. She emphasised the importance of cleanliness while asking the officers for laying focus on solid waste management, regular garbage lifting, sanitation and beautification of the town.

The Commissioner Secretary highlighted the necessity of people’s participation in keeping the city clean.
